| Openning and Closing Doors Causes Serious Car Accidents in Los Angeles |
In the state of California it is illegal for any person to open a car door on the side of moving traffic unless it will not hinder the flow of traffic. If opening the car door would pose a threat to the driver or passenger of any other vehicle this action is considered illegal by the California Department of Motor Vehicles. This statute also applies to leaving car doors opened on the side of the car that is facing moving traffic.
Serious car accidents and fatal motorcycle accidents have been caused as the result of the careless act of opening a car door near a busy road. It is important that drivers and passengers act cautiously when exiting or entering a vehicle that is parked or stopped near moving traffic. If an on coming truck, car, or motorcycle hits the open door the driver or passengers could sustain life threatening injuries.
